Written by Remzi H. Arpaci-Dusseau and Andrea C. Arpaci-Dusseau, this highly regarded textbook is entirely free to read online. It breaks down the subject into three core areas: Virtualization, Concurrency, and Persistence.

An operating system (OS) is the core software that manages a computer's hardware components and provides common services for computer programs. Textbooks covering this subject, including those by Indian authors and professors like Vijay Shukla, typically focus on a standard core curriculum.
